Steve Rowe created SOLR-10407:
---------------------------------
Summary: v2 API introspect output: availableSubPaths should be
sorted
Key: SOLR-10407
URL: https://issues.apache.org/jira/browse/SOLR-10407
Project: Solr
Issue Type: Bug
Security Level: Public (Default Security Level. Issues are Public)
Reporter: Steve Rowe
This makes it hard to find things, since you have to read through the whole
(possibly lengthy) list to find what you're looking for.
E.g. after {{bin/solr -e cloud -noprompt}}, {{curl }} returns:
{noformat}
{
"spec":[ [...] ],
[...]
"availableSubPaths":{
"/c/gettingstarted/shards/{shard}":["DELETE",
"POST",
"GET"],
"/c/gettingstarted/shards":["POST",
"GET"],
"/c/gettingstarted/shards/{shard}/{replica}":["DELETE",
"GET"],
"/c/gettingstarted/browse":["POST",
"GET"],
"/c/gettingstarted/schema/fieldtypes/{name}":["GET"],
"/c/gettingstarted/schema/name":["GET"],
"/c/gettingstarted/config/requestDispatcher":["GET"],
"/c/gettingstarted/schema/zkversion":["GET"],
"/c/gettingstarted/config/znodeVersion":["GET"],
"/c/gettingstarted/schema/uniquekey":["GET"],
"/c/gettingstarted/schema/version":["GET"],
"/c/gettingstarted/schema/dynamicfields/{name}":["GET"],
"/c/gettingstarted/config/params":["POST",
"GET"],
"/c/gettingstarted/schema/similarity":["GET"],
"/c/gettingstarted/select":["POST",
"GET"],
"/c/gettingstarted/schema/solrqueryparser":["GET"],
"/c/gettingstarted/config":["POST",
"GET"],
"/c/gettingstarted/schema":["POST",
"GET"],
"/c/gettingstarted/config/overlay":["GET"],
"/c/gettingstarted/config/query":["GET"],
"/c/gettingstarted/config/jmx":["GET"],
"/c/gettingstarted/export":["POST",
"GET"],
"/c/gettingstarted/schema/dynamicfields":["GET"],
"/c/gettingstarted/config/{plugin}":["GET"],
"/c/gettingstarted/get":["GET"],
"/c/gettingstarted/schema/fieldtypes":["GET"],
"/c/gettingstarted/config/params/{params_set}":["GET"],
"/c/gettingstarted/query":["POST",
"GET"],
"/c/gettingstarted/schema/solrqueryparser/defaultoperator":["GET"],
"/c/gettingstarted/schema/copyfields":["GET"],
"/c/gettingstarted/schema/fields":["GET"],
"/c/gettingstarted/schema/fields/{name}":["GET"],
"/c/gettingstarted/admin/ping":["POST",
"GET"],
"/c/gettingstarted/update/json/commands":["POST"],
"/c/gettingstarted/update/xml":["POST"],
"/c/gettingstarted/update/json":["POST"],
"/c/gettingstarted/update/csv":["POST"],
"/c/gettingstarted/update/bin":["POST"],
"/c/gettingstarted/update":["POST"]}}
{noformat}
--
This message was sent by Atlassian JIRA
(v6.3.15#6346)
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]